
Transported Asset Protection Association (TAPA)
The Transported Asset Protection Association (TAPA) is an organization focused on reducing theft and loss in the logistics and transportation sectors. It brings together businesses, law enforcement, and security experts to create standards and best practices for protecting valuable goods during transport. TAPA develops guidelines, certifications, and training to help companies improve their security measures and reduce risks. By promoting collaboration and sharing intelligence about threats, TAPA aims to enhance the safety and security of supply chains worldwide, ultimately protecting businesses and consumers from the impacts of cargo theft.
